Episode Summary

On the pod this week, co-hosts Austin Karp and Mollie Cahillane discuss Warner Bros. Discovery’s decision to split into separate entities. They break down how they expect it to work and what this means for the broader sports media landscape. The duo then deep dive into the NBA Finals and Stanley Cup Final viewership numbers and experience. Later in the pod, ESPN’s Holly Rowe explains how reality far exceeded expectations on Women’s College World Series viewership.
